Normandale Highlands, located between Normandale Lake and Hyland Lake Park Reserve, is a residential and park-adjacent Bloomington neighborhood with wooded streets and mid-century ramblers.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Normandale Lake Park loop and the trailheads near the Normandale Lake Bandshell, where walkers, cyclists, and picnic blankets set the tempo. Split-levels and 1960s-era homes sit on curving lots, with pockets of prairie-edge landscaping near the water. The landscape reads as green and gently rolling, shaped by lakes, wetlands, and long trail corridors. Normandale Lake Park and Hyland Lake Park Reserve function as the daily backdrop for runs, paddling, and winter ski tracks. Bush Lake Ski Jump and the Bloomington Center for the Arts add a local cultural throughline beyond the shoreline.

The Single-Family Residential R-1 District is intended to: Serve as the core zoning district for single-family residential uses; Allow compatible non-single family residential and institutional uses; and Protect natural resources and ensure compatible redevelopment through appropriate development standards.
